Why Mold Develops in Punta Gorda Crawl Spaces
The Southeast has the highest year-round mold pressure in the country. Warm, humid air entering through foundation vents condenses on cooler surfaces and feeds mold within 24β48 hours. Many Southeast homes accumulate visible mold colonies long before owners notice β typically discovered during inspection for a sale or after the mold migrates upward into the HVAC system. Remediation here without addressing humidity afterward almost always leads to re-growth within 12β18 months.
Health Symptoms Linked to Crawl Space Mold
Symptoms commonly reported in Southeast homes with crawl space mold: persistent allergy-like symptoms, sinus congestion, asthma flare-ups, fatigue, musty smell on clothing/upholstery, and worsening symptoms during humid months. Toxic mold (Stachybotrys) can cause neurological symptoms and requires evacuation during remediation.
Common Mold Types in Florida Crawl Spaces
- β’Aspergillus / Penicillium (most common, allergenic)
- β’Cladosporium (musty smell, common on wood)
- β’Stachybotrys chartarum (toxic black mold β flag for immediate professional remediation)
- β’Chaetomium (water-damaged wood, often with Stachybotrys)
- β’Fusarium (in flooded crawl spaces)
What a Proper Remediation in Punta Gorda Looks Like
- 1Containment with negative-air HEPA scrubbers (prevents migration into living space)
- 2PPE-protected manual removal of contaminated insulation, vapor barrier, debris
- 3Antimicrobial treatment of all wood surfaces (joists, subfloor, sill plates)
- 4HEPA vacuum every surface, including band joist
- 5Post-clearance air sampling by an independent inspector
- 6Encapsulation + dehumidifier installation (preventing re-growth)
Insurance Coverage in Florida
Most Southeast homeowner policies cover sudden water-event mold (burst pipe, hurricane) but NOT gradual humidity-driven mold. Document the source β if the mold is from a covered event, file within the policy notice window (typically 30β60 days). Some Southeast carriers explicitly exclude mold above $10K β check your policy before paying out of pocket.
Post-Remediation Care
In the Southeast, post-remediation care is non-negotiable: install a crawl space dehumidifier, encapsulate, and maintain humidity below 55%. Without this, re-growth typically occurs within 12β18 months and you pay for remediation twice.

When should I schedule mold remediation in Punta Gorda?
Schedule between October and April when humidity is lower and remediation can be completed before the MayβSeptember peak growth season. Avoid summer remediation β re-contamination risk is high before the dehumidifier is installed.
Expected ROI
Avoiding one major HVAC contamination (which spreads mold throughout the home, often $15Kβ$40K to remediate) typically pays for crawl space remediation many times over. Resale value: documented mold remediation with clearance test plus encapsulation typically restores $10Kβ$25K to home value vs documented unremediated mold.
